As a part of the company, the financial department is responsible for managing the financial activities of the enterprise, including fund raising, investment decision-making, cost control and profit management. The responsibility of the financial department is to ensure the health, compliance and transparency of the company's financial situation, thus providing strong support for the company's long-term development. The finance department is one of the most closely related departments within the company. It needs to cooperate with all departments of the company to formulate and implement correct financial policies and ensure that all financial activities of the company conform to legal and ethical standards.
The financial department is also responsible for monitoring and analyzing the company's financial data, providing accurate information on the company's financial situation and helping the company's leaders make wise decisions. The financial department also plays an important role in the company's strategic planning. It needs to work out a strategic plan with other departments of the company to ensure the long-term development and success of the company. The financial department also plays an important role in the implementation of the strategic plan, providing necessary financial support and guarantee to ensure the realization of the company's strategic objectives.
Financial characteristics:
1, numerical type
Financial activities involve the movement of funds and the calculation of quantity, so they are numerical. The financial department needs to record and calculate the company's income, expenditure, cost, profit and other financial data, and use numerical values to represent these data. For example, the financial department needs to record the company's sales, costs, taxes, profit margins and other values for financial analysis and decision-making.
2. Authenticity
Financial activities must be true and reliable, and financial data shall not be fabricated or forged. The financial department must process the financial data according to the real vouchers and account records to ensure that it truly reflects the company's financial situation. The financial department needs to follow accounting standards and regulations to ensure the accuracy and compliance of financial data.
3. Complexity
Financial activities involve a wide range and complex contents, including fund-raising, investment and capital operation. These aspects are interrelated and influenced each other, forming a complex financial system. In addition, financial activities also involve knowledge and skills in accounting, taxation, auditing and other fields, which need professional financial personnel to manage. Therefore, financial activities are a highly professional and complex work.
